Between the pandemic and the hard-to-avoid homeowner’s insurance hikes- insuring a home is a challenge today-especially if your roof is in disrepair. One Kansas City neighborhood had a scare recently after a nearby home caught on fire. The community began to talk amongst themselves about the importance of home insurance when they discovered a neighbor and friend in need. Cedrick Walker had tried to insure his home but was rejected due to the condition of his roof. After a recent hailstorm in Eastern Iowa, Shamrock Roofers have been called to over 100 homes that have discovered damage traced to the 2020 Derecho storm. Last year, more than 200,000 insurance claims were made for damaged roofs in the Eastern Iowa area. Since last week’s hailstorm, more and more homeowners are realizing that they may have had roof damage all along.
